What Defines the Best Adventure Motorcycles for Long-Distance Touring?

The right adventure motorcycle for long-distance touring balances comfort with capability, offering features that handle extended highway miles while maintaining off-road competence. Understanding these defining characteristics helps you select a machine suited to your touring goals.

Key Features to Look For

Ergonomics and comfort stand as the foundation of any long-distance touring motorcycle. You need an upright riding position with adjustable handlebars and foot pegs that accommodate your body type.

A seat height that allows both feet to touch the ground provides confidence during stops, while seat padding must support multi-hour riding sessions without causing discomfort.

Fuel capacity directly determines your range between stops. Most capable adventure tourers carry 5 to 6.5 gallons, providing 200 to 300 miles of range depending on engine size and riding conditions.

Wind protection through adjustable windscreens reduces fatigue on highway stretches. Look for screens you can modify on the fly without tools.

Luggage capacity separates weekend riders from serious tourers. Factory hard cases or robust mounting points for aftermarket systems let you carry clothing, camping gear, and supplies. Weight capacity matters equally, check the manufacturer’s maximum load rating.

Modern adventure motorcycles combine long-distance travel capability with off-road performance through sophisticated electronics. Traction control, multiple riding modes, and ABS systems adapt to changing terrain conditions.

Differences Between Adventure and Touring Bikes

Adventure bikes prioritize versatility over specialization. They feature longer suspension travel (7 to 9 inches), knobby or dual-sport tires, and higher ground clearance than dedicated touring machines. This design philosophy means you can handle gravel roads, river crossings, or mountain passes that would stop a traditional tourer.

Touring motorcycles excel on pavement with lower seat heights, smoother suspension tuned for highways, and more comprehensive weather protection. They typically carry larger fairings, built-in audio systems, and passenger-focused amenities.

Weight distribution differs significantly between categories. Adventure bikes position their center of gravity higher for obstacle clearance, while tourers keep weight low for stability at highway speeds. A fully loaded adventure bike weighs 550 to 650 pounds, compared to 800+ pounds for full-dress tourers.

Adventure riding historically meant literal long-distance travel into remote areas rather than equal splits between pavement and dirt. This heritage influences modern designs that favor durability and simplicity over luxury features.

Benefits of Adventure Motorcycles for Touring

Route flexibility represents the primary advantage of adventure bikes for touring. You’re not confined to paved roads when detours, construction, or curiosity arise. That scenic overlook accessed by a dirt road becomes an option rather than an obstacle.

Rider visibility improves with the tall riding position. You see over traffic and spot road hazards earlier than riders on lower machines. Other drivers also notice you more easily.

Maintenance simplicity benefits from adventure bike engineering. Many models use air-cooled or simpler engine designs that prove easier to service in remote locations. Parts availability often exceeds specialized touring models, particularly in developing regions.

Resale value remains strong because adventure motorcycles serve as capable multi-terrain platforms appealing to diverse rider types. The used market stays active year-round compared to seasonal interest in pure touring bikes.

Physical engagement keeps you alert during long days. The active riding position and need to manage the bike through varying terrain reduces the highway hypnosis that affects touring riders on straight interstates.

Top Adventure Motorcycles for Long-Distance Touring in 2026

The BMW R 1300 GS leads with advanced electronics and refined comfort, while KTM’s 1290 Super Adventure S delivers aggressive performance with exceptional wind protection. Honda’s Africa Twin Adventure Sports balances reliability with off-road prowess, and the Triumph Tiger 1200 Explorer offers sophisticated touring features in a commanding package.

2026 BMW R 1300 GS

The R 1300 GS represents BMW’s flagship adventure tourer, powered by a 1,300cc boxer twin engine producing approximately 145 horsepower. You get adaptive ride height adjustment, electronic suspension that responds to road conditions in real-time, and a TFT display with full connectivity features.

The adventure motorcycle category has evolved significantly, and this BMW exemplifies that progression. Your luggage capacity exceeds 100 liters with factory panniers, while the electronically adjustable windscreen provides excellent protection at highway speeds.

Key Features:

  • Adaptive cruise control with radar
  • Heated grips and seats as standard
  • Multiple riding modes for varied terrain
  • Shaft drive for minimal maintenance

The ergonomics accommodate riders from 5’7″ to 6’3″ comfortably. Your seat height adjusts between 850mm and 890mm, making it accessible despite its size. The bike weighs approximately 549 pounds wet, which feels manageable once moving thanks to the low center of gravity.

KTM 1290 Super Adventure S

KTM’s 1290 Super Adventure S delivers 160 horsepower from its LC8 V-twin engine, making it the most powerful option in this segment. You’ll find semi-active WP suspension that adjusts compression and rebound automatically, along with cornering ABS and traction control.

The fuel tank holds 6.1 gallons, giving you a theoretical range of 250+ miles depending on riding style. Your touring comfort benefits from the 30mm taller windscreen compared to the standard model, and the quick-shifter works seamlessly in both directions.

Performance Specifications:

  • Engine: 1,301cc V-twin
  • Power: 160 hp @ 9,500 rpm
  • Torque: 103 lb-ft @ 6,500 rpm
  • Weight: 518 lbs (wet)

The electronics package includes adaptive cruise control, blind spot detection, and a 7-inch TFT screen with navigation. Your throttle response adjusts through multiple maps, from smooth touring to aggressive sport settings. The bike excels at high-speed highway cruising while remaining capable on gravel roads.

Honda Africa Twin Adventure Sports

Honda’s Africa Twin Adventure Sports prioritizes reliability and versatility with its 1,084cc parallel-twin engine producing 101 horsepower. You get a larger 6.4-gallon fuel tank compared to the standard Africa Twin, extending your range to approximately 280 miles between fill-ups.

The suspension offers 9.1 inches of travel front and rear, giving you genuine off-road capability without sacrificing on-road comfort. Your riding position remains upright and neutral, reducing fatigue during all-day rides. The DCT (Dual Clutch Transmission) option eliminates clutch work in traffic and technical terrain.

Standard Equipment:

  • Showa electronically adjustable suspension
  • Apple CarPlay connectivity
  • LED lighting throughout
  • Aluminum skid plate

The Africa Twin weighs 534 pounds with DCT, making it lighter than most competitors. Your maintenance intervals stretch to 8,000 miles for oil changes, and Honda’s reputation for durability means fewer unexpected repairs. The bike handles equally well on Interstate highways and forest service roads.

Triumph Tiger 1200 Explorer

The Tiger 1200 Explorer features a 1,160cc inline-triple engine delivering 148 horsepower with a distinctive exhaust note. You receive Triumph’s Optimized Cornering ABS and traction control that work through a six-axis IMU, providing confident braking even while leaned over.

Your comfort benefits from electronically adjustable Showa suspension, a spacious seat, and extensive wind protection from the large touring screen. The F 900 GS Adventure offers balance, but the Tiger 1200 provides more power and features for serious touring.

Technology Highlights:

  • 7-inch TFT with turn-by-turn navigation
  • Adaptive cornering lights
  • Hill hold control
  • My Triumph connectivity app

The fuel tank holds 5.3 gallons, delivering approximately 220 miles of range. Your seat height adjusts from 850mm to 870mm, and the bike tips the scales at 566 pounds ready to ride. The Explorer variant includes crash bars, fog lights, and center stand as standard equipment, making it the most tour-ready configuration Triumph offers.

Performance and Comfort on Extended Journeys

Long-distance adventure touring demands motorcycles that balance powerful performance with rider comfort across hundreds of miles. The right combination of engine capability, suspension tuning, and ergonomic design determines whether your multi-day journey becomes an unforgettable adventure or an endurance test.

Engine Power and Efficiency

You need an engine that delivers consistent power without constantly stopping for fuel. Most adventure motorcycles built for touring feature engines between 800cc and 1300cc, providing the torque necessary for loaded riding and highway passing.

Modern parallel-twin and boxer engines typically offer 5.0 to 6.5 gallons of fuel capacity with ranges exceeding 200 miles per tank. V-twin and inline-four configurations deliver smoother power delivery at highway speeds, though they may consume slightly more fuel.

Key Engine Considerations:

  • Horsepower range: 90-160 hp for loaded touring
  • Torque delivery: Low to mid-range torque matters more than peak numbers
  • Fuel economy: 40-55 mpg depending on load and riding style
  • Tank capacity: Larger tanks reduce fuel stop frequency

Suspension and Ride Quality

Your suspension absorbs everything from highway expansion joints to gravel roads over extended periods. Electronic suspension systems let you adjust damping on the fly, adapting to different loads and road conditions without tools.

Premium adventure bikes offer 7-9 inches of suspension travel with adjustable preload, compression, and rebound damping. Semi-active systems automatically adjust based on speed, acceleration, and road conditions.

You should expect fully-loaded capabilities that maintain stability with luggage and a passenger. Quality suspension prevents bottoming out on rough roads while keeping the ride compliant enough for all-day comfort.

Seat Comfort and Ergonomics

Your riding position and seat quality directly impact how many hours you can ride before fatigue sets in. Adventure touring seats typically measure 30-35 inches in height with generous padding designed for 300+ mile days.

Adjustable handlebars, footpegs, and windscreens let you customize your riding position. Wide, well-padded seats with proper contouring distribute weight across your sit bones rather than creating pressure points.

Ergonomic Features That Matter:

  • Adjustable seat height (typically 1-2 inches of range)
  • Heated grips and seats for cold weather touring
  • Wind protection that redirects airflow away from your chest
  • Natural arm and leg angles that reduce strain

Motorcycles designed for comfortable long-distance touring integrate these elements to minimize rider fatigue across varying terrain and weather conditions.

Technology and Rider Assist Features

Modern adventure motorcycles now include sophisticated electronics that enhance safety, navigation, and rider confidence across varied terrain. These systems range from real-time route guidance to intervention technologies that help prevent accidents in challenging conditions.

Integrated Navigation and Connectivity

Most 2026 adventure motorcycles feature TFT displays with built-in navigation or smartphone connectivity through Bluetooth systems. You can access turn-by-turn directions, music controls, and phone calls directly from the dash without taking your hands off the bars.

Premium models offer dedicated navigation systems with off-road mapping and track recording capabilities. These systems let you save routes, mark waypoints, and share your favorite rides with other riders through companion apps.

Connectivity packages typically include features like automatic emergency calling, theft tracking, and remote diagnostics. You can check tire pressure, fuel range, and service intervals through your smartphone before starting a long journey.

Advanced Rider Aids

Cornering ABS represents the most significant safety advancement in adventure motorcycles for real-world riding. This system adjusts braking force based on lean angle, preventing wheel lockup even when braking mid-corner on unstable surfaces.

Traction control systems now feature multiple modes tailored to different terrain types. You can select settings optimized for pavement, gravel, sand, or mud, with some bikes offering up to seven pre-configured riding modes.

Cruise control has become standard on long-distance touring models, reducing fatigue on extended highway stretches. Semi-active suspension systems automatically adjust damping based on road conditions, load weight, and riding style for optimal comfort and handling.

Lighting and Visibility Enhancements

LED headlights with adaptive beam technology adjust light patterns based on lean angle and speed. You get better illumination through corners without blinding oncoming traffic, which proves essential when riding unfamiliar mountain roads at night.

Cornering lights activate additional LED units when turning, illuminating the inside of curves where standard headlights leave dark spots. Some manufacturers include fog lights and auxiliary spotlights for improved visibility in adverse weather conditions.

Daytime running lights increase your visibility to other motorists during daylight hours. Many bikes now incorporate dynamic turn signals that sweep in the direction you’re turning, making your intentions clearer to surrounding traffic.

Luggage and Storage Solutions

Adventure motorcycles designed for long-distance touring require robust luggage systems that balance capacity, accessibility, and weather protection. The choice between factory-integrated options and aftermarket solutions depends on your specific touring needs and budget constraints.

Factory-Mounted Luggage Options

Many manufacturers now offer purpose-built luggage systems engineered specifically for their adventure platforms. BMW’s proprietary case systems feature seamless integration with their GS models, including matched paint options and dedicated mounting points that maintain the bike’s weight distribution.

Honda’s factory panniers and top cases use keyed-alike systems for convenience, while Yamaha’s hard luggage options for the Ténéré 700 prioritize durability without excessive weight. These factory luggage systems typically include crash protection and warranty coverage.

Key advantages of factory options:

  • Pre-engineered mounting systems that don’t require modifications
  • Matched aesthetics and color schemes
  • Manufacturer warranty protection
  • Optimized weight distribution and handling characteristics

Factory systems typically cost more upfront but eliminate compatibility concerns and installation challenges.

Aftermarket Luggage Systems

Aftermarket manufacturers like SW-MOTECH, Givi, and Touratech offer extensive luggage options that often exceed factory capacities. These systems provide flexibility in choosing between hard cases and soft panniers based on your riding style.

Soft luggage systems from brands like Kriega and Giant Loop reduce weight and offer collapse-when-empty convenience for mixed on-road and off-road touring. Hard cases provide superior security and weather protection for extended trips requiring hotel stays and valuable gear storage.

Popular aftermarket configurations:

  • Aluminum panniers (35-45L per side) with top case (35-50L)
  • Soft pannier systems with roll-top waterproofing
  • Hybrid setups combining hard top cases with soft side bags

Many riders choose aftermarket systems when they need specialized features like quick-release mechanisms, expandable capacity, or compatibility across multiple motorcycles in their garage.

Cost of Ownership and Maintenance

Adventure motorcycles designed for long-distance touring require significant upfront investment, with pricing varying substantially based on engine size and technology features. Maintenance intervals and parts availability directly impact your total ownership costs over the bike’s lifetime.

Initial Purchase Price

Entry-level adventure motorcycles typically start around $8,000 to $12,000 for models in the 650-700cc range. These bikes offer solid reliability and adequate performance for most touring needs without premium electronics packages.

Mid-range adventure tourers in the 850-950cc category generally cost between $13,000 and $16,000. You’ll find improved suspension components, better wind protection, and more advanced rider aids at this price point.

Premium adventure motorcycles exceed $18,000 and can reach $25,000 or more for fully-equipped models. These flagship machines include radar-assisted cruise control, semi-active suspension, comprehensive electronics suites, and higher-quality materials throughout. The 2026 adventure motorcycle market features multiple options across all price categories.

Long-Term Maintenance Considerations

Service intervals vary considerably between manufacturers, with some brands requiring valve checks every 6,000 miles while others extend this to 26,000 miles or more. Longer maintenance intervals reduce both shop time and ongoing costs throughout ownership.

Chain-driven models need regular chain maintenance and replacement every 15,000-25,000 miles, adding $200-400 per replacement cycle. Shaft-drive systems eliminate chain maintenance but typically cost more to repair if problems develop.

Adventure bikes suited for economical touring often feature common engine platforms shared across multiple models, improving parts availability and reducing costs. Tire replacement represents a significant recurring expense, with high-quality adventure tires costing $300-500 per set and lasting 5,000-8,000 miles depending on road versus off-road use.

Global Availability and Dealer Networks

When selecting an adventure motorcycle for long-distance touring, you need to consider where you can purchase, service, and repair your bike both at home and abroad.

Major Manufacturer Networks

The largest adventure motorcycle brands maintain extensive dealer networks across multiple continents. BMW, Honda, Yamaha, and KTM offer the widest global coverage, with authorized dealers in most countries you’re likely to visit. This means you can find replacement parts and qualified technicians in Europe, North America, Asia, and increasingly in South America and Africa.

Suzuki and Triumph also provide solid international coverage, though their presence may be limited in remote regions. You should verify dealer locations along your planned routes before committing to a purchase.

Parts Availability Considerations

Popular models like the BMW R 1300 GS, Yamaha Ténéré 700, and Honda Africa Twin benefit from widespread parts availability. You can often find components at dealerships within 24-48 hours in urban areas.

Lesser-known manufacturers may require you to order parts internationally, which can delay repairs by weeks. This becomes critical when you’re touring in remote areas far from major cities.

Service and Warranty Support

Your manufacturer’s warranty coverage varies by region. Some brands offer international warranties that remain valid regardless of where you purchase the bike. Others limit coverage to the country of sale, which affects your long-term ownership costs and peace of mind during extended trips abroad.
